Transitioning from a highly specialized, public-facing role like a professional athlete to a different career path often presents unique challenges. The sudden shift in identity, the loss of a familiar routine, and the pressure of a new environment can be daunting. However, this period also offers an unparalleled opportunity for growth and reinvention. Think about the strategic thinking involved in predicting an opponent's move, or the collaborative spirit essential for team success. These translate directly into business acumen, problem-solving capabilities, and effective teamwork. Successful career pivots often involve:
- Auditing existing skill sets: What truly makes you exceptional beyond your sport?
- Targeting industries: Where do your passions and aptitudes align with market demand?
- Upskilling strategically: What new knowledge or certifications are required?
- Leveraging your network: How can your existing connections open new doors?
Jonas Myhre is a Norwegian former footballer who played as an attacking midfielder. He spent the majority of his career in Norway, with spells in England and Denmark. Myhre was also capped 33 times for the Norway national team, scoring seven goals.
